本文目录
- HTML5如何通过canvas,把两张图片绘制到画布,然后导出大图
- html5 canvas怎么用
- 谁能告诉我怎么用Flash导出html5的网页吗
- html5中canvas画的图形如何打印以及导出pdf
- html5用canvas怎么实现动画效果
HTML5如何通过canvas,把两张图片绘制到画布,然后导出大图
《img src="......." id="img1" /》《img src="......." id="img2" /》《img id="img3" /》
var img1 = document.getElementById("img1"), img2 = document.getElementById("img2"), img3 = document.getElementById("img3");var canvas = document.createElement("canvas"), context = canvas.getContext("2d");canvas.width = img1.naturalWidth + img2.naturalWidth;canvas.height = Math.max(img1.naturalHeight,img2.naturalHeight);// 将 img1 加入画布context.drawImage(img1,0,0,img1.naturalWidth,img1.naturalHeight);// 将 img2 加入画布context.drawImage(img1,img2.naturalWidth,0,img2.naturalWidth,img2.naturalHeight);// 将画布内容导出var src = canvas.toDataURL();img3.src = src;
《p》drawImage 的使用方法可以去这里看一下《/p》***隐藏网址***
html5 canvas怎么用
1) svg绘制出来的每一个图形元素都是独立的DOM节点,可方便后期绑定事件或修改,而canvas输出的是一整幅画布;2) svg输出的图形是矢量的,后期可以修改参数来自由放大缩小,无失真,canvas输出标量画布,就像一张图片一样。如果您认可我的答案,请采纳。您的采纳,是我答题的动力,O(∩_∩)O谢谢!!
谁能告诉我怎么用Flash导出html5的网页吗
如果你用的是早期版本,可能不行,Flash CC的话你打开上方命令菜单,点击“转换为其他文档格式”就可以转为HTML5 Canvas格式输出的文档,这样你就可以正常输出了,如果还是弄不明白的话你可以百度一下秒秒学,上面有专门的教程学习,希望对你有帮助。
html5中canvas画的图形如何打印以及导出pdf
JScript codevar canvas = document.getElementById("mycanvas"); var img = canvas.toDataURL("image/png");document.write(’《img src="’+img+’"/》’);打印是浏览器的事。用JS调用也是调用浏览器的功能,这种情况直接按CTRL+P去处理。至于PDF,装软件,只要能打印的都可以通过软件生成PDF。若想在HTML5里用纯代码实现导出PDF是实现不了的。
html5用canvas怎么实现动画效果
方法/步骤素材准备,基本框架的建立。这里我们让一个有字的图片从左到右运动起来。1.素材:图片一张。2.框架的建立(如下图)3.将图片素材引入网页。4.定义canvas标签,获取canvas的上下文。5.定义一个画图片的函数,使用canavs绘图API里面的drawImage来完成。6.写一个更新的函数,因为我们要让他动起来,所以每时刻绘制的地方都不一样。注意:这儿要用clearRect,这个函数,主要是为了清空画布。7.写定时函数,每隔0.2秒就更新一次,重新绘制。我们来看看最终的效果和所有代码吧!